export function isPrivate(address: string) {
    return /^(::f{4}:)?10\.([0-9]{1,3})\.([0-9]{1,3})\.([0-9]{1,3})$/i
            .test(address) ||
        /^(::f{4}:)?192\.168\.([0-9]{1,3})\.([0-9]{1,3})$/i.test(address) ||
        /^(::f{4}:)?172\.(1[6-9]|2\d|30|31)\.([0-9]{1,3})\.([0-9]{1,3})$/i
            .test(address) ||
        /^(::f{4}:)?127\.([0-9]{1,3})\.([0-9]{1,3})\.([0-9]{1,3})$/i.test(address) ||
        /^(::f{4}:)?169\.254\.([0-9]{1,3})\.([0-9]{1,3})$/i.test(address) ||
        /^f[cd][0-9a-f]{2}:/i.test(address) ||
        /^fe80:/i.test(address) ||
        /^::1$/.test(address) ||
        /^::$/.test(address);
}

export function isPublic(address: string) {
    return !isPrivate(address);
}

export function isLoopBack(address: string) {
    return /^(::f{4}:)?127\.([0-9]{1,3})\.([0-9]{1,3})\.([0-9]{1,3})/.test(address) ||
        /^fe80::1$/.test(address) ||
        /^::1$/.test(address) ||
        /^::$/.test(address);
};

export function getInternalIP(standard: 4 | 6 = 4): string | null {
    if (standard !== 4 && standard !== 6) {
        throw new Error(`getInternalAddr error, expect standard to be 4 or 6, got ${standard}`);
    }

    const interfaces = os.networkInterfaces();

    const ips = Object.keys(interfaces).map(name => {
        const addresses = interfaces[name].filter(info => {
            const familyGot = info.family.toLowerCase();
            return familyGot === `ipv${standard}`
                && !isLoopBack(info.address);
        });

        return (addresses[0] || {} as any).address;
    }).filter(Boolean);

    return ips[0] || loopBack(standard);
}
